During the International Economic Forum on the theme of "Russia Islamic World: Kazan Forum" held in Kazan, Oleg Neretin, President of the Russian Federation Institute of Industrial Property (FIPS), revealed to the media that the number of invention patent applications in Russia increased by 8% year-on-year in the first four months of 2023.
This year, we have noticed an increase in the number of invention applications submitted by Russian applicants. In the first four months of this year, compared to the same period last year, the number of applications increased by 8%
He pointed out that this is a quite important indicator. And, this is a positive indicator because any technology comes from ideas that must be protected. Obviously, patents are the most powerful mechanism for protecting intellectual property rights.
Various regions in Russia are working diligently. The Tatarstan region is one of the institutions that cooperate with the Russian Federal Intellectual Property Office (Rospatent), especially from the perspective of submitting invention applications. Niridin said, "In terms of application activities in Russia, Tatarstan ranks fourth." According to statistics, last year Rospatent received about 700 applications from the Tatarstan region and issued 600 patents. He also added that the number of applications involving computer programs submitted by Tatarstan has doubled.
